The Vice Chancellor, Federal University Lokoja (FUL), Professor Olayemi Akinwumi, has inaugurated a 17-member steering committee to begin groundwork for the establishment of medical sciences programme in the university.

Performing the ceremony over the weekend, Professor Akinwumi said the inauguration was sequel to the Senate approval to establish medical and engineering courses in the institution at its 61st special meeting on Thursday.

Professor Akinwumi was optimistic that the medical college will commence operations next academic session.

The committee members who were appointed based on their academic track records were Professor Mike Ozovehe Ogirima of the Ahmadu Bello University Zaria as Coordinator/Chairman and Mr. Usman Abdul Kadir as Secretary.

Responding on behalf of the committee members, the Coordinator/Chairman of the committee, Professor Mike Ogirima promised to live up to expectation in delivering the assignment on time.
